Table 1 The average scores (± SD) of the six foraging variables for Japanese quails in the two patch use experiments: total feeding time (TFT), total food intake (TFI), frequency of patch shifts (FPS), mean speed of inter-patch movement (MSM), mean residence time during the first (MRF) and last half of the feeding trial (MRL)

From: Food patch use of Japanese quail (Coturnix japonica) varies with personality traits

Foraging variables

Experiment 1

Experiment 2

Female

Male

Female

Male

TFT (s)

1895.3 ± 432.2

1902.7 ± 393.6

1841.0 ± 476.4

1944.1 ± 454.0

TFI (g)

2.6 ± 1.5

3.1 ± 1.4

3.1 ± 2.5

3.2 ± 1.7

FPS

6.8 ± 5.8

7.5 ± 5.1

6.0 ± 7.1

6.7 ± 5.2

MSM (m/s)

0.17 ± 0.10

0.18 ± 0.13

0.20 ± 0.12

0.18 ± 0.10

MRF (s)

868.2 ± 524.1

864.0 ± 488.1

792.5 ± 464.1

779.5 ± 457.6

MRL (s)

301.8 ± 339.2

253.9 ± 244.1

420.9 ± 315.0

356.1 ± 347.6
